PetSmart Declares Quarterly Dividend

Updated

PetSmart is continuing to pass along some of the money it earns from providing goods and services to animals. The company has declared its latest quarterly dividend, which is to be $0.165 per share paid on August 16 to shareholders of record as of August 2. That amount matches each of the firm's preceding four distributions, the most recent of which was handed out last month. Prior to that, PetSmart distributed $0.14 per share.

The firm has managed to raise its dividend over the years. Since late 2003, that payout has climbed from $0.02 to the present level.

The just-declared dividend annualizes to $0.66 per share. That yields just under 1% at PetSmart's current stock price of $68.89.
